Details
-
Task
-
Resolution: Done
-
P1: Critical
-
6.2.6, 6.3, 6.4.0 RC1, 6.4, 6.5.0 Beta1
-
6.3.1, 6.4.0 Beta2
-
Qt 6.3.1
Qt 6.4 beta 2
-
-
6ea2a1cdb7 (qt/qtdeclarative/dev) 6ea2a1cdb7 (qt/tqtc-qtdeclarative/dev) 981cb8a3e9 (qt/tqtc-qtdeclarative/6.2) cfb3438ecc (qt/qtdeclarative/6.4) cfb3438ecc (qt/tqtc-qtdeclarative/6.4) 40f82b9b88 (qt/qtdeclarative/6.3) 40f82b9b88 (qt/qtdeclarative/6.3.2)
Description
This works only if any js is invoked.
See the bug in action: IyqhZotKL8.mp4
Repo: https://gitlab.com/kelteseth/ScreenPlay
Internally it uses LIST_PROPERTY macro that is defined herem that is a wrapper around QQmlListProperty https://gitlab.com/kelteseth/ScreenPlay/-/blob/master/ScreenPlayUtil/inc/public/ScreenPlayUtil/ListPropertyHelper.h#L58
If it helps, I could recreate this issue in a test project.
Attachments
For Gerrit Dashboard: QTBUG-105137 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
423547,2 | QQmlListAccessor: Accept QQmlListProperty | dev | qt/qtdeclarative | Status: MERGED | +2 | 0 |
423802,3 | QQmlListAccessor: Accept QQmlListProperty | 6.4 | qt/qtdeclarative | Status: MERGED | +2 | 0 |
423803,4 | QQmlListAccessor: Accept QQmlListProperty | 6.3 | qt/qtdeclarative | Status: MERGED | +2 | 0 |
423804,3 | QQmlListAccessor: Accept QQmlListProperty | tqtc/lts-6.2 | qt/tqtc-qtdeclarative | Status: MERGED | +2 | 0 |